What is STEM Education?
STEM Education:
 integrates science, engineering, technology and
mathematics
 focus on
 the application of knowledge to real-life problem solving
 development of new products or procedures
 benefiting daily living and livelihood.
Vision and Objectives
Vision:
 To drive STEM Education in Thailand with a view to enhancing
the competitiveness of the human resources in Science,
Mathematics and Technology in the international arena.
Vision and Objectives
Mission:
 To create public awareness of the importance of STEM
Education.
 To promote and develop STEM education networks at national
and international levels.
 To promote cooperation among the public sector, the private
sector and the communities in supporting the local STEM
education efforts.
 To recognize STEM talents by their induction into the STEM Hall
of Fame or appointment as STEM Ambassadors.
 To promote and develop database systems, learning resources,
and learning media on digital platforms (iSTEM).
Strategies
 School and national assessment aligning with STEM
education principles and objectives.
 Classroom and external STEM activities encouraging
analytical thinking and real-life problem solving.
 Teachers professional development with professional
guidance by STEM Ambassadors.
 Inclusiveness of all sectors in STEM education.

Education System in Thailand
 Compulsory education:- Grade 1-9
 Elementary: G1-G6
 Secondary: G7-G9
 Post Compulsory education
 Prepare for University: G10 – G12
 Prepare for career: Vocational school
 Types of K-12 Schools
 Elementary School : K, G1-G6 (Kindergarten, Pratom 1-6)
 Extended Elementary School : K, G1-G9 (Kindergarten , Pratom 1-6,
Mattayom 1-3)
 Secondary School : G7-G12 (Mattayom 1-6)

Impacts
 Learners attain higher science, mathematics and
technology learning achievement and are able to
identify their future career opportunities.
 Teachers at all grade levels not only possess the
informed view of STEM education, but also develop
and teach integrative STEM lesson effectively.
 Thailand will have STEM workforce that can raise
the country’s economy status.
